The total number of new
one year highs and new one year lows within an index or ETF is
calculated for the specified data period. There is a definite
tendency that one new high will be followed by subsequent new highs.
When new one year highs decline, be cautious. When they decline
after several days of new highs, a consolidation or correction may
be eminent. New highs may also mark the beginning of a price move.
The total number of
first day new
one year highs and new one year lows represents the total
number of components within the index attaining new highs or lows
for the first time (consecutive new highs or lows are not counted).
Similar statistics are
provided for the last one quarter period to provide similar
indications but with a shorter term outlook. |
